Carbon was the primary login server until it was replaced by [[Murphy]]. Between then and 2010 it performed a variety of small tasks. With the arrival of [[Morpheus]] in 2009 and [[Worf]] in 2010 the remaining services were migrated allowing Carbon to become a dedicated development machine. It is intended that Carbon will in future follow the six month Ubuntu release cycle (rather than the LTS cycle generally followed) so users can access more recent development tools/libaries.
In August 2010, during the server room move, Carbon got a RAM upgrade from 2G to 4G, the extra ram in question coming from Data.
